long drop

What does long drop mean?

An outdoor non-flushing toilet over a deep pit, common at baches, campsites and huts.

"There's just a long drop at the hut, so bring your own paper."

Origin

New Zealand term describing a pit toilet with a 'long drop' to the pit below.

Frequently asked questions

What is a long drop toilet?
It's an outdoor non-flushing toilet built over a deep pit, common at New Zealand baches, campsites and back-country huts.
Why is it called a long drop?
Because waste falls a long way down into the deep pit below the seat, giving the toilet its 'long drop'.
Where would you find a long drop?
Typically at rural huts, campsites and holiday baches where there's no plumbing or flushing toilet.
